Repairing the ignition Cylinder
The ignition piston could be the cause of your key not turning or inserted into your ignition. This is a tiny piece of equipment that makes sure only the right key is used to start the vehicle. The part is comprised of series pins and tumblers that lock and unlock when the key moves in a specific sequence through the ignition switch. If the tumblers get damaged or stuck, it can prevent the key from going all the way into the ignition switch or being removed.
It is essential to replace the ignition cylinder as soon as you can when it's not functioning properly. This can protect your vehicle from being taken if it's left in the "On" position. It will ensure that you won't experience any problems starting your engine or using accessories such as the radio or power windows.
In order to replace the ignition cylinder, it will need to be disassembled. This procedure will vary based on manufacturer. Based on the model, you might have to remove the steering wheel, wiper switch and other interior components to access the ignition switch. Once the ignition cylinder has become accessible, it needs to be pushed with the help of a screwdriver or another tool to remove it from the switch. After the fasteners and all push pins are removed the new ignition cylinder will then be installed.

Transponder Key Replacement
Many cars manufactured between the mid-to-late 1990s are equipped with transponder chips in their key fobs, and as well as the blade that is fitted into the ignition. The transponder transmits a digital signal to the receiver inside the vehicle when the key is placed in the ignition. If this code is not correct it will cause the engine to not start. If you lose your keyfob you'll require a key that is transponder-equipped to start your vehicle.
The replacement key might include a microchip, contingent on the model of your car.
